Skimless or Scottie?

Active: Skimless publishes current product and pricing pages for its private audio briefing service.[1][2]

Short answer: Skimless wins for a private podcast-style briefing you can hear on a commute. Scottie wins for a compact written morning brief with an inspectable source trail and quick scanning.[1][2]

Choose Skimless if…

  • Audio-first delivery and a private podcast feed fit commutes and screen-free catch-up.[1][2]
  • It supports newsletters, YouTube, feeds, blogs, documentation, and changelogs with multilingual output.[1][2]

Choose Scottie if…

  • Scottie's written rundown is designed for fast visual triage before the reader decides where to go deeper.
  • Included and left-out items remain visible with original links, which is easier to inspect than a linear audio session.

What Skimless does best

Skimless turns newsletters, video, feeds, blogs, documentation, and changelogs into audio delivered through a private podcast feed. Multilingual output and team plans make it especially relevant when listening is the preferred consumption mode.[1][2]

Who should choose which

  • Choose Skimless when screen-free listening is the non-negotiable part of the habit.
  • Choose Scottie when you need to skim, verify, and act on a cited written edition.
